摘要
Poly(γ-benzyl-L-glutamate) microspheres were prepared from γ-benzyl-L-glutamate N-carboxy-α-amino acid by precipitation polymerization in polystyrene solution. The effect of the polystyrene concentration, characteristics of solvents and weight ratio of polystyrene/monomer and monomer/initiator was investigated. The particle size of the microspheres was decreased with increasing the concentration of polystyrene and increased with increasing the weight ratio of polystyrene/monomer. It was found that the microspheres are distributed and uniformly spherical particles, but are slightly elongated shape. Particle size and average molecular weight of the microspheres were distributed in the region of 0.75-1.48 μm, 2.7-3.4×104 respectively.
